... Read moreVisiting the zoo offers an invaluable opportunity for children to connect with nature and develop a curiosity about the animal kingdom. During these trips, kids can observe creatures like turtles, hedgehogs, snakes, and camels up close, which fosters both learning and empathy towards wildlife. Engaging with animals firsthand can help children understand biodiversity and the importance of conservation. Parents often find that their child’s fascination grows as they witness animals' behaviors, sounds, and habitats, making these moments educational and memorable. To make the most of a zoo day, consider preparing your child with some introductory facts about the animals you plan to see. Encouraging questions and discussions during the visit can deepen their understanding and enthusiasm. Moreover, many zoos offer interactive exhibits and educational programs tailored for young visitors. Participating in these activities can enrich the zoo experience and inspire a lifelong love for animals and nature.
